> Also, not reading the Emacs end of the pipe, while the process runs is
> probably going to get is to undefined behavior in some situations,
> especially with multithreaded processes.

I don't think it's undefined behavior -- you may just hang (one or more 
threads of) the subprocess.  Of course, then it is stopped, much as if 
by SIGSTOP.
